完成后,保存并退出配置文件,并重启MySQL服务器: sudoservicemysql restart 1. 结论 通过仔细检查MySQL服务器是否启动、套接字文件路径、监听IP地址和端口配置,你可以解决“ERROR 2002 (HY000): Can’t connect to local MySQL server through socket”错误。请根据具体情况检查并调整配置,以便正确连接到本地MySQL服务...
今天执行mysql操作的时候出现了错误: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ock'问题 1:首先检查是否安装了mysql-server了 sudo apt-getinstall mysql-servertoinstall mysqlonubuntu sudo apt-get install mysql-server to install my...
在Python中连接MySQL时,可以使用mysql-connector或pymysql等库。以下是使用mysql-connector库的示例代码: importmysql.connector config={'user':'username','password':'password','host':'localhost','database':'database',}try:cnx=mysql.connector.connect(**config)print('Connected successfully')cnx.close()e...
$%mysql-uroot-p Enter password:ERROR2002(HY000):Can't connect to local MySQL server through socket'/tmp/mysql.sock'(2) 结果报了一个 ERROR 2002 ... 大概的意思是连接不上本地服务器的 socket 文件。 mysql 命令连接数据库时,如果不指定服务器的 host 参数,那么会连接到本地数据库服务器 (host 参...
由于“socket”文件是由mysql服务运行时创建的,如果提示“ERROR 2002 (HY000): Can’t connect to local MySQL server through socket ‘***’ (2)”,找不到“socket”文件,我们首先要确认的是mysql服务是否正在运行。 (1)、端口是否打开 [root@lam7 opt]# lsof -i:3306 ...
ERROR 2002 (HY000): Can't connect to MySQL server on '192.168.564.118' 1、如果要新增账号就按照下面进行操作,如果不需要新增账号则无需这一步。 mysql> SELECT user, host FROM mysql.user WHERE user = 'root' AND host = '%'; +---+---+ | user |...
在启动MySQL服务时,如果磁盘空间不足,则MySQL也无法启动。我们可以通过使用“df -h”命令来查看磁盘剩余空间是否够用。 #5. MySQL配置文件错误 在有些情况下,MySQL的配置文件可能被修改,导致MySQL无法启动。我们可以检查MySQL的配置文件是否正确,通常该文件位于/etc/mysql/my.cnf。
mysqldump: Got error: 2002: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2) when trying to connec 2. 问题原因 上述报错已指明是因为mysql的socket文件读取异常(文件可能已删除),导致socket无法连接所致 2.1 确认当前MySQL的socket netstat -ln | grep mysql 或者查看...
ERROR 2002 (HY000): Can’t connect to local MySQL server through socket ‘/var/lib/mysql/mysql.sock’ (2) [root@lam7 opt]# mysql -h 127.0.0.1 (用此方法是可以进入到MariaDB,可以进入之后忽略此问题) Welcome to the MariaDB monitor. Commands end with ; or \g. Your MariaDB connection id...
在安装好了MySQL之后,使用了新的配置文件后,MySQL服务器可以成功启动,但在登陆的时候出现了ERROR 2002 (HY000): Can't connect to local MySQL server through socket,即无法通过socket连接到mysql服务器,同时提供了socket文件的位置。下面是这个问题的描述与解决办法。